Where Does Your Case Get Heard?

All Oakville criminal charges go to the Milton Courthouse at 491 Steeles Avenue East. This court handles every criminal case in Halton Region - Oakville, Burlington, Milton, and Halton Hills. It runs both Ontario Court of Justice and Superior Court. It's modern, efficient, and the Crowns (Crown attorneys - prosecutors) are well-prepared.

Can You Avoid a Criminal Record?

For a first-time offender in Oakville, avoiding a record is often possible. Halton Crown attorneys have discretion - meaning they can choose - to resolve cases through diversion, a conditional discharge, or a peace bond. None of those result in a criminal record. But you need to present your background clearly and effectively.

A criminal record follows you everywhere - job checks, US border entry, professional licences, immigration status. Even a minor conviction can cause major problems. Protecting your record starts on day one. For more on how records work, read criminal records in Ontario.

What Happens After You're Charged in Oakville?

After a criminal charge in Oakville, your first court date at the Milton Courthouse is set within a few weeks. At that date, your lawyer confirms they are on the file and requests disclosure. Disclosure is the evidence package - officer's notes, witness statements, surveillance footage, and any other materials police collected. Reviewing it is where the defence starts.

Halton Region Crown attorneys are well-prepared. They know their disclosure and they follow their files closely. That means your lawyer needs to know the disclosure better - and identify the issues before the Crown uses them against you.

What Defences Are Available?

The defence depends on the charge. For impaired driving, the most productive areas are Charter challenges to the traffic stop, challenges to the Approved Instrument readings, and the two-hour presumption. For assault, the key issues are credibility, prior inconsistent statements, and whether the Crown can prove force was applied without consent. For drug charges, the search is almost always the central issue. For fraud, the intent element - proving you meant to deceive - is where the Crown is most vulnerable.

Regardless of the charge, you have the right to know the Crown's full evidence, to challenge how it was obtained, and to test it at trial if no fair resolution is reached.
